Abstract:
The endophytic fungal strains isolated from different ages of
Platycladus orientalis in Huangdi Mausoleum of Huangling County in Shaanxi Province were identified by tissue isolation method combined with molecular biological data and morphological characteristics. The endophytic fungi showed the highest isolation rate of 53.2% at the age less than 100 years. While the age greater than or equal to 100 years with the age less than 600 years, and the age greater than or equal to 600 years, the separation rate was lower, 24.6% and 24.8% respectively. The endophytic fungi of different age stages showed rich diversity, and the index was between 2.4 and 2.7. The similarity of endophytic fungi population was different in different age stages. The similarity coefficient of endophytic fungi between the age greater than or equal to 100 years with less than 600 years and greater than or equal to 600 years was 0.743; The similarity between the age less than 100 years and the age greater than or equal to 100 years with less than 600 years was 0.526; The similarity between the age less than 100 years and the age greater than or equal to 600 years was 0.541. Dominant species of
Dimorphospora, Epicoccum, Alternaria, and
Paecilomyces were the predominant microflora of all age groups.
